1. Remittance (Noun)

Meaning: भेजी हुई रकम : An amount of money that you send to someone.

Synonyms: Payment, Pay, Allowance

Example Sentence: She sends a small remittance home to her parents each month.

2. Diaspora (Noun)

Meaning: प्रवासी : A group of people who spread from one original country to other countries.

Synonyms: Migration, Displacement, Dispersal, Movement, Dispersion

Example Sentence: When war broke out in their home country, a diaspora of refugees settled in a neighboring nation.

3. Seamless (Adjective)

Meaning: निरंतरतायुक्त : Smooth and continuous, with no apparent gaps.

Synonyms: Perfect, Flawless, Impeccable, Faultless, Unblemished

Antonyms: Imperfect, Bad, Inadequate, Defective

Example Sentence: Although there were some hiccups along the way, the project seemed seamless on the outside.

4. Agog (Adjective)

Meaning: उत्सुक : Very eager or curious to hear or see something.

Synonyms: Eager, Excited, Impatient

Antonyms: Apathetic, Unenthusiastic, Incurious

Example Sentence: I’ve been agog all afternoon, waiting for the next part of your story.

5. Freebie (Noun)

Meaning: मुफ्त : A thing given free of charge.

Synonyms: Gift, Donation, Bonus, Giveaway, Present, Reward

Antonyms: Expensive, Extortionate, Overpriced

Example Sentence: The store gives customers a freebie with their purchases.

6. Animadversion (Noun)

Meaning: निन्दा : Criticism or censure.

Synonyms: Harsh Criticism, Disapproval

Antonyms: Extol, Laud, Praise

Example Sentence: He was infuriated by their constant animadversion.

7. Mire (Noun)

Meaning: मुसीबत में फँसना : A situation of distress or difficulty that's hard to escape.

Synonyms: Mess, Trouble, Difficulty, Rattrap

Example Sentence: Because the girl chose to become friends with a drug dealer, she now finds herself in a mire of suspicion.

8. Interlocutor (Noun)

Meaning: वार्ताकार : A person who takes part in a dialogue and represents someone else.

Synonyms: Dialogist, Conversationalist, Speaker

Example Sentence: Abraham was able to act as interpreter and interlocutor for our group.

9. Callous (Adjective)

Meaning: कठोर : Showing or having an insensitive and cruel disregard for others.

Synonyms: Ruthless, Merciless, Heartless, Cruel, Unfeeling

Antonyms: Sympathetic, Compassionate, Merciful

Example Sentence: The professor was callous and cold, and no one wanted to remain in the class.

10. Startle (Verb)

Meaning: चौंकाना : Cause to feel sudden shock or alarm.

Synonyms: Shock, Stun, Astonish, Astound, Stupefy

Antonyms: Assure, Soothe, Cheer, Comfort

Example Sentence: If the music is too loud, it will startle the sleeping baby.
